Lily Burana book signing and Sugar Shack in SF on Thursday, May 14, 2009

Lady Satan of Sugar Shack let me know that they're having a combination benefit show and book signing with Lily Burana (http://www.lilyburana.com/) next week at the Hypnodrome on 1oth Street.

Lily Burana is a writer who has published in various publications including The Washington Post, GQ, The New York Times, Self, Glamour, Entertainment Weekly, Details, and others. I remember reading some of her articles!

So she's a former "punk rock stripper," who has fallen in love with a man in uniform and found herself a military wife while her husband is in Iraq. So what does she do to entertain the other wives? Teach them burlesque!

That's the focus of the story of her latest book, I Love a Man in Uniform. She'll be at the Hypnodrome next week signing copies of her book, and there will be a show featuring some of the SF's burlesque stars.
